National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ration and Marine Electronics

A web release by http://www.northeastmarineelectronics.com/ today notes that mariners can now get free electronic downloads of the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ration’s (NOAA) Raster Navigational Charts (RNCs).
Such charts improve safety and efficiency in marine transportation. These charts are digitally scanned images of a paper nautical chart used by mariners for navigation.

NOAA say they will endeavour to produce official raster charts and deliver weekly updates with notices containing local navigational information to Mariners. They will also provide a cumulative file of updates with Notice to Mariner information for each chart edition. This will be posted on the Web site: http://nauticalcharts.noaa.gov.
